物联网可视化开发平台如何实现数据可视化效果与物联网平台生态的协同?

随着物联网技术的不断发展,物联网可视化开发平台应运而生,为用户提供了强大的数据可视化功能。然而,如何实现数据可视化效果与物联网平台生态的协同,成为了许多开发者关注的焦点。本文将深入探讨物联网可视化开发平台在实现数据可视化效果与物联网平台生态协同方面的策略和方法。

一、物联网可视化开发平台概述

物联网可视化开发平台是指将物联网设备采集到的数据进行实时处理、存储、分析,并通过可视化界面展示的平台。该平台主要具备以下特点:

  1. 数据采集:通过传感器、摄像头等设备,实时采集物联网设备产生的数据。

  2. 数据处理:对采集到的数据进行清洗、转换、分析等处理,提高数据质量。

  3. 数据存储:将处理后的数据存储在数据库中,以便后续查询和分析。

  4. 数据可视化:通过图表、地图等形式,将数据直观地展示给用户。

  5. 交互性:支持用户与物联网设备进行交互,实现对设备的远程控制。

二、数据可视化效果与物联网平台生态的协同

物联网可视化开发平台要实现数据可视化效果与物联网平台生态的协同,需要从以下几个方面入手:

  1. 数据融合:将来自不同物联网设备的异构数据进行融合,形成统一的数据视图。这需要平台具备强大的数据处理能力,能够对海量数据进行实时处理。

  2. 可视化技术:采用先进的可视化技术,如3D地图、实时图表等,将数据以更直观、更生动的形式展示给用户。以下是一些具体的技术手段:

    • WebGL技术:利用WebGL技术实现3D可视化,让用户在网页上就能体验到三维效果。

    • 地图服务:利用地图服务,将物联网设备的位置信息以地图形式展示,方便用户进行空间分析。

    • 实时图表:通过实时图表,展示物联网设备的状态变化,让用户及时了解设备运行情况。

  3. 设备管理:物联网可视化开发平台应具备设备管理功能,实现对物联网设备的远程监控、配置、升级等操作。以下是一些具体的应用场景:

    • 远程监控:用户可以通过平台实时查看物联网设备的运行状态,及时发现异常情况。

    • 设备配置:用户可以通过平台对物联网设备进行配置,如设置报警阈值、修改参数等。

    • 设备升级:平台支持远程升级,方便用户对物联网设备进行维护。

  4. 生态协同:物联网可视化开发平台应与物联网平台生态中的其他组件协同工作,如云计算、大数据、人工智能等。以下是一些协同策略:

    • 云计算:利用云计算资源,实现数据存储、处理、分析等任务的高效运行。

    • 大数据:通过大数据技术,对物联网设备产生的海量数据进行挖掘和分析,为用户提供有价值的信息。

    • 人工智能:利用人工智能技术,实现对物联网设备的智能控制和优化。

三、案例分析

以某智慧城市项目为例,该项目的物联网可视化开发平台实现了数据可视化效果与物联网平台生态的协同。以下是该项目的一些亮点:

  1. 数据融合:平台将来自不同传感器、摄像头等设备的数据进行融合,形成统一的数据视图。

  2. 可视化技术:采用3D地图、实时图表等技术,将数据以直观、生动的形式展示给用户。

  3. 设备管理:平台支持对物联网设备的远程监控、配置、升级等操作。

  4. 生态协同:平台与云计算、大数据、人工智能等生态组件协同工作,实现了智慧城市的智能化管理。

总之,物联网可视化开发平台在实现数据可视化效果与物联网平台生态的协同方面具有重要作用。通过数据融合、可视化技术、设备管理和生态协同等方面的努力,物联网可视化开发平台将为用户提供更加高效、便捷的数据可视化服务。

猜你喜欢:根因分析